Transaction 42e4ea90bcfd250f9217469064f5cbbc8651b492199251d4b8773e9741b40e83
1 Input
2 Outputs
- 42e4ea90bcfd250f9217469064f5cbbc8651b492199251d4b8773e9741b40e83:0
- 42e4ea90bcfd250f9217469064f5cbbc8651b492199251d4b8773e9741b40e83:1
value 1580850
address 1LpPxdKx8fLBtxzfbDZ6urg2MDMhyHyVbx
value 10760489
address 1DfZ6djuQvNUay41WdZ66AyBazqVVba6oe